West Hempstead is a town with different aspects to its different parts. Near the Hempstead border, near old National LIquidators, its an eyesore, yet Cathedral Gardens, located just north of Liquidators is beautiful. Eagle Ave area has seen better days, but the Maple Ave area, just a few blocks away, is gorgeous. Parts of Lakeview also has a West Hempstead mailing address, further adding to the confusion .
